Break-in your new outboard motor as
follows.
Break-in operation allows the mating
surfaces of the moving parts to wear
evenly and thus ensures proper
performance and longer outboard
motor life.
The gearshift lever has 3 positions:
FORWARD, NEUTRAL, and
REVERSE.
An indicator at the base of the
gearshift lever aligns with the icon
attached at the base of the gearshift
lever.
Turn the throttle grip to SLOW to
decrease engine speed before moving
the gearshift lever.
The throttle mechanism is designed
to limit throttle opening in
REVERSE and NEUTRAL. Do not
turn the throttle grip with force in the
FAST direction. The throttle can be
opened to FAST only in FORWARD
gear.
For the first 10 hours of operation,
run the outboard motor at low speed,
avoid prolonged full-throttle speed,
and avoid abrupt operation of the
throttle.
